Comparing top k lists
 In Proceedings of the ACMSIAM Symposium on Discrete Algorithms
, 2003
"Motivated by several applications, we introduce various distance measures between "top k lists." Some of these distance measures are metrics, while others are not. For each of these latter distance measures, we show that they are "almost " a metric in the following two seemingly unrelated aspects: (
Cited by 272 (4 self)
Motivated by several applications, we introduce various distance measures between “top k lists.” Some of these distance measures are metrics, while others are not. For each of these latter distance measures, we show that they are “almost ” a metric in the following two seemingly unrelated aspects
Formalizing design spaces: Implicit invocation mechanisms
 In VDM ’91
"An important goal of software engineering is to exploit commonalities in system design in order to reduce the complexity of building new systems, support largescale reuse, and provide automated assistance for system development. A significant roadblock to accomplishing this goal is that common prope
Cited by 118 (26 self)
of old ones in a principled way, at reduced cost to designers and implementors. To illustrate these points, we present a formalization of a system integration technique called implicit invocation. We show how many previously unrelated systems can be viewed as instances of the same underlying framework
DEEP MATHEMATICAL RESULTS ARE THE ONES THAT CONNECT SEEMINGLY UNRELATED AREAS: TOWARDS A FORMAL PROOF OF
"When is a mathematical result deep? At rst glance, the answer to this question is subjective: what is deep for one mathematician may not sound that deep for another. A renowned mathematician GianCarlo Rota expressed an opinion that the notion of deepness is more objective that we may think: namely,
, that a mathematical statement is deep if and only if it connects two seemingly unrelated areas of mathematics. In this paper, we formalize this thesis, and show that in this formalization, Gian Carlo Rota's thesis becomes a provable mathematical result.
Connectivism: A learning theory for the digital age."
 International Journal of Instructional Technology and Distance
, 2005
"Jan 2005 Index Home Page Editor's Note: This is a milestone article that deserves careful study. Connectivism should not be con fused with constructivism. George Siemens advances a theory of learning that is consistent with the needs of the twenty first century. His theory takes into account t
Cited by 147 (2 self)
unrelated fields over the course of their lifetime. Informal learning is a significant aspect of our learning experience. Formal education no longer comprises the majority of our learning. Learning now occurs in a variety of ways through communities of practice, personal networks, and through completion
Contamination in Formal Argumentation Systems
"Over the last decennia, many systems for formal argumentation have been defined. The problem, however, is that these systems do not always satisfy reasonable properties. In this paper, we focus on the particular property that a conflict between two arguments cannot keep other unrelated arguments fro
Cited by 13 (4 self)
Over the last decennia, many systems for formal argumentation have been defined. The problem, however, is that these systems do not always satisfy reasonable properties. In this paper, we focus on the particular property that a conflict between two arguments cannot keep other unrelated arguments
Formal symplectic groupoid
 Commun. Math. Phys
"Abstract. The multiplicative structure of the trivial symplectic groupoid over R d associated to the zero Poisson structure can be expressed in terms of a generating function. We address the problem of deforming such a generating function in the direction of a nontrivial Poisson structure so that t
Cited by 14 (5 self)
generating function reduces exactly to the CBH formula of the associated Lie algebra. The methods used to prove existence are interesting in their own right as they come from an at first sight unrelated domain of mathematics: the Runge–Kutta theory of the numeric integration of ODE’s. 1.
Formal verification of synchronizers
 In CHARME 2005
, 2005
"Abstract. Large Systems on Chips (SoC) comprise multiple clock domains, and interdomain data transfers require synchronization. Synchronizers may fail due to metastability, but when using proper synchronization circuits the probability of such failures can be made negligible. Failures due to unexpe
Cited by 3 (0 self)
to unexpected order of events (caused by interfacing multiple unrelated clocks) are more common. Correct synchronization is independent of event order, and can be verified by model checking. Given a synchronizer, a correct protocol is guessed, verification rules are generated out of the protocol specification
Whom You Know Matters: Venture Capital Networks and Investment Performance,
 Journal of Finance
, 2007
"Abstract Many financial markets are characterized by strong relationships and networks, rather than arm'slength, spotmarket transactions. We examine the performance consequences of this organizational choice in the context of relationships established when VCs syndicate portfolio company inv
Cited by 138 (8 self)
syndicate if neither led the syndicate in question. Indegree is a measure of the frequency with which a VC firm is invited to coinvest in other VCs' deals, thereby expanding its investment opportunity set and gaining access to information and resources it otherwise may not have had access to. Formally
Applying Formal Methods to Programming
, 2004
"To my grandparents, Domenico, Giuseppe and Angela which are not here anymore, and Maria. "In theory, there is no difference between theory and practice. But, in practice, there is." — Jan L.A. van de Snepscheut T HIS THESIS concerns the design and evolution of two programming languages. The two cont
contributions, unrelated with each other, are treated separately. The underlying theme of this work is the application of formal methods to the task of programming language design and implementation. Jeeg We introduce Jeeg, a dialect of Java based on a declarative replacement of the synchronization mechanisms
FORMALIZING DARWINISM, NATURALIZING MATHEMATICS
"In the last decades two different and apparently unrelated lines of research have increasingly connected mathematics and evolutionism. Indeed, on the one hand, different attempts to formalize Darwinism have been made (see for a survey Barberousse and Samadi, 2015; Thompson, 2007), while, on the othe
In the last decades two different and apparently unrelated lines of research have increasingly connected mathematics and evolutionism. Indeed, on the one hand, different attempts to formalize Darwinism have been made (see for a survey Barberousse and Samadi, 2015; Thompson, 2007), while
